springdoc-openapi-ui 注解的主要作用是增强 API 文档的可读性和可用性。通过注解,开发者可以描述 API 的各种信息,如接口的路径、方法、参数、返回值、安全认证等。这些信息将被 springdoc-openapi-ui 自动解析并生成相应的文档,使得其他开发者或使用者能够轻松理解和使用 API。 3. 常用的 springdoc-openapi-ui 注...
如果有人使用您的 Swagger 文档,要为基于标准 Spring MVC 的应用程序启用 Springdoc,您需要将以下依赖项包含到 Maven 中pom.xml。 代码语言:javascript 代码运行次数:0 运行 AI代码解释 <dependency><groupId>org.springdoc</groupId><artifactId>springdoc-openapi-webmvc-core</artifactId><version>1.2.32</ver...
spring:application:name: springdoc-openapiserver:port: 8080# === SpringDoc配置 ===#springdoc:swagger-ui:# 自定义的文档界面访问路径。默认访问路径是/swagger-ui.htmlpath: /springdoc/docs.html# 字符串类型,一共三个值来控制操作和标记的默认展开设置。它可以是“list”(仅展开标记)、“full”(展开标...
SpringDoc是一款可以结合SpringBoot使用的API文档生成工具,基于OpenAPI 3,目前在Github上已有1.7K+Star,更新发版还是挺勤快的,是一款更好用的Swagger库!值得一提的是SpringDoc不仅支持Spring WebMvc项目,还可以支持Spring WebFlux项目,甚至Spring Rest和Spring Native项目,总之非常强大,下面是一张SpringDoc的架构图。 mac...
springdoc-openapi 中自定义动态枚举enum值,步骤1:添加 @Schema 注解到枚举@Schema(description="短信场景枚举(scene值即接口参数)")publicenumSmsSceneEnumimplementsIntArrayValuable{ //原有枚举项保持不变}步骤2:实现自定义ModelConverter@Componentpubli
Springdoc中使用对象进行Query查询时样式及类型解析问题 1. 准备工作 项目中引入springdoc依赖 <dependency> <groupId>org.springdoc</groupId> <artifactId>springdoc-openapi-ui</artifactId> <version>1.6.11</version> </dependency> 1. 2. 3.
SpringDoc有着更加先进的技术架构和更好的扩展性,使得其逐渐取代了springfox-boot-starter工具包,成为了当前Spring Boot生态中最受欢迎的API文档工具之一。同时springdoc-openapi-ui还拥有更为完善的开发文档和社区支持,从而吸引了越来越多的开发者加入到这个项目中。因此作为一个Spring Boot开发者,如果想要快速、方便地...
org.springdoc»springdoc-openapi-securityApache SpringDoc OpenAPI Security Last Release on Mar 12, 2024 3.Knife4j OpenAPI3 Spring Boot Starter38usages com.github.xiaoymin»knife4j-openapi3-spring-boot-starterApache Spring Boot autoconfigure
springdoc-openapi 是一个用于 Java 的开源库工具,它能够帮助 Spring Boot 项目自动生成 API 文档。这一库通过运行时检查应用并根据 Spring 配置、类结构以及各种注释来推断 API 语义,进而自动生成 JSON/YAML 和 HTML 格式的文档。借助 springdoc-openapi,开发者可以轻松地在生成的文档中添加补充信息,...
springdoc-openapi是一个用于生成和展示OpenAPI文档的开源库。它是基于Spring Boot和Spring WebFlux的,可以帮助开发人员快速构建和发布RESTful API,并自动生成符合OpenAPI规范的文档。 springdoc-openapi的主要特点包括: 自动生成文档:通过简单的注解,springdoc-openapi可以自动扫描和解析代码,生成API的详细文档,包括接口路径、...